About this role
Employer: Pay@
Pay@, a leading payment aggregator and provider of secure payment solutions, is looking for a Senior Data Analyst to join their growing team based in Stellenbosch. This role focuses on enabling data-driven decision-making, improving data structures, and supporting business reporting across the organisation.
The ideal candidate is a proactive, self-directed individual with strong analytical ability, excellent attention to detail, and the ability to work both independently and collaboratively in a fast-paced environment.
Responsibilities include:
• Analyse and maintain an understanding of the SQL Server data environment, including data structures and flows.
• Develop and maintain data documentation, including data dictionaries.
• Translate business reporting requirements into data solutions.
• Write and optimise SQL queries for data extraction and analysis.
• Build and maintain Excel-based reports and dashboards.
• Perform ad hoc analysis to support business decision-making.
• Identify and recommend improvements to data structures and performance.
• Support testing, validation, and data quality processes.
• Assist business users with data and reporting queries.
• All other tasks related to the role.
Minimum requirements:
• Degree in a relevant quantitative field (Information Systems, Computer Science, Engineering, Mathematics, Statistics or Finance).
• 8-10 years’ experience in a similar data analysis role.
• Strong SQL skills.
• Experience documenting data architectures, data models, or data dictionaries.
• Demonstrated ability to build and maintain Excel-based reports and dashboards.
• Strong communication skills in English with the ability to work effectively with both technical teams and non-technical business stakeholders.
• Own reliable transport.
Advantageous:
• Experience with data modelling or database optimisation.
• Exposure to Power BI or similar tools.
• Python experience.
• Familiarity with Agile / Scrum delivery practices.
• Experience in fintech, payments or financial services.
